 function checkRechercheRapide() {

	var regexpWhitespace = /^\s+$/;
	var regexpEmail = /\w{1,}[@][\w\-]{1,}([.]([\w\-]{1,})){1,3}$/;
	var str = '';
	var msgErr = '';
	
	
	var surface = frm.surface.value;
	var montantMax = frm.montantMax.value;
	var montantMin = frm.montantMin.value;
	
	
	
	// alert(document.forms['frm'].elements['titre_fr'].value);
	
	//tests d'existence des champs
	
	if (montantMin.length > 0 && !regexpWhitespace.test(montantMin)) {
		if (isNaN (montantMin)) { //nombre KO
			msgErr += "Le montant minimum est invalide !\n";	
		}
	} 
	
	
	if (montantMax.length > 0 && !regexpWhitespace.test(montantMax)) {
		if (isNaN (montantMax)) { //nombre KO
			msgErr += "Le montant maximum est invalide !\n";	
		}
	} 
	
	
	
	//Si les 2 montants sont valides et ont été saisis
	if (montantMin.length > 0 && montantMax.length > 0 && msgErr == '') {
		
		if (montantMin*1 > montantMax*1) {
			msgErr += "Le montant minimum doit être inférieur au montant maximum !\n";	
		}
	}
	
	
	if (surface.length > 0 && !regexpWhitespace.test(surface)) {
		if (isNaN (surface)) { //nombre KO
			msgErr += "La surface est invalide !\n";	
		}
	} 
	
	
	
	
	
	
	
	
	//affichage des erreurs
	if (msgErr != '') {
		alert ("Le formulaire n'est pas valide :\n\n" + msgErr);
	}
	
	
	return (msgErr == '');
}

	
